InternLM-XComposer: A Vision-Language Large Model for Advanced Text-image Comprehension and Composition

Bin Wang, Chao Xu, Conghui He, Dahua Lin, Hang Yan, Haodong Duan, Jiaqi Wang, Jingwen Li, Kai Chen, Linke Ouyang, Pan Zhang, Shuangrui Ding, Songyang Zhang, Wei Li, Wenwei Zhang, Xiaoyi Dong, Xingcheng Zhang, Xinyue Zhang, Yuhang Cao, Yu Qiao, Zhiyuan Zhao

InternLM-XComposer generates articles with automatically inserted context-appropriate images while achieving state-of-the-art results on vision-language benchmarks.

Claims

C1strongest claim

Our model consistently achieves state-of-the-art results across various mainstream benchmarks for vision-language foundational models, including MME Benchmark, MMBench, MMBench-CN, Seed-Bench, CCBench, QBench and Tiny LVLM.

C2weakest assumption

That the custom human-plus-GPT-4V evaluation procedure for text-image composition reliably measures quality and that the training data strategies produce genuine comprehension rather than benchmark overfitting.

C3one line summary

InternLM-XComposer generates articles with seamlessly integrated images and achieves state-of-the-art results on vision-language benchmarks including MME, MMBench, and Seed-Bench.
